Healthy Planet Application Analyst
The role of the Healthy Planet Application Analyst is pivotal in supporting the optimal functioning of the Healthy Planet application at a leading healthcare provider. Key Responsibilities: Guiding workflow design to ensure seamless integration with connected software systems. Building, testing, and troubleshooting systems to guarantee high performance. Analyzing technical issues associated with Epic and other connected software, providing expert solutions. Serving as primary support contact for the Healthy Planet applications, establishing trust and effective relationships with stakeholders. Adapting to changing end-user business needs by demonstrating flexibility and a strong work ethic. Essential Qualifications: A bachelor's degree or license/certification in a clinical specialty. Relevant experience in Epic modules such as Healthy Planet and population health management. Prior certification, experience, or proficiency in one or more Epic modules, particularly Healthy Planet, is highly desirable.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to seek out additional assignments or tasks and help others when needed. Preferred Candidate Profile: Strong understanding of population health management, care management, and value-based care, including knowledge of HEDIS measures and ambulatory care management workflows. Ability to communicate effectively with project leadership and subject matter experts, fostering trust and collaboration.
